EA’s infamous Star Wars Battlefront 2 blunder has earned it a Guinness World Record

By Darryn Bonthuys
September 9, 2019
in :  Gaming
12

Star Wars Battlefront 2 had just been released and something was rotten in the state of Denmark. Loot boxes were out of control, the chances of unlocking a character to use in a multiplayer game required a grind of note and in a spot of damage control, EA’s mystery community manager of reddit left a comment that had players fuming. A comment that would go on to make history.

EA and DICE respond to Star Wars Battlefront II’s loot box problem

By Darryn Bonthuys
October 13, 2017
in :  Gaming
13

Star Wars Battlefront II’s loot boxes however, may just be the worst of the lot. The recent multiplayer beta revealed a system which is very much built on paying to win, offering easy access to perks and player progression if the sound of your coin is just right. That has of course resulted in an uproar from fans, players who aren’t happy that a recommended retail price investment also offers anyone with a few dollars more an easy leg up.
